Protection Dogs For People And   Their Families

A protection dog for families is a specially trained canine that is raised and trained to provide security and protection to a household. These dogs are not just pets but are also highly skilled in various aspects of protection work, which may include deterring potential threats, defending against intruders, and providing a sense of security to their human family members. Here are some key characteristics and functions of a protection dog for families:

GUARDING:
Protection dogs are trained to recognize and respond to potential threats. They can alert their owners to suspicious activities or intruders by barking or taking a defensive posture.
PERSONAL PROTECTION:
These dogs can be trained to physically intervene if a threat escalates. They may be taught to apprehend or deter intruders, but they are usually trained to use controlled force without causing unnecessary harm.
FAMILY COMPANIONS:
Despite their protective training, protection dogs are typically friendly and loyal companions to their families.
They are often well-socialized and can be integrated into family life.
OBEDIENCE AND CONTROL:
Protection dogs are highly trained in obedience and control. They respond to specific commands from their owners and trainers, allowing them to switch between protective and non-protective modes.
SITUATIONAL AWARENESS:
These dogs are alert and have a heightened sense of awareness, making them excellent at detecting changes in their environment.
TRAINING:
The training of a protection dog is extensive and requires professional handling. Ti typically includes obedience training, bite work, and controlled aggression training.
LEGAL CONSIDERATIONS:
It’s important to be aware of the legal regulations related to owning a protection dog. The use of a protection dog in self-defense must comply with local laws and regulations, and responsible ownership is crucial.
CONTINUOUS CARE AND TRAINING:
A protection dog requires ongoing training and socialization to maintain its skills and behaviors. Regular exercise, mental stimulation, and medical care are also essential.
